Bank of America Addresses Bond Portfolio Concerns for Investors.

Bank of America's CFO, Alastair Borthwick, reassured investors about $99 billion of unrealized losses on its bond portfolio during the company's earnings conference call. The bank's bond portfolio is classified as held-to-maturity for accounting purposes. Borthwick emphasized that the bank's net interest income would rise in a higher-rate environment.

Goldman Sachs Acquires Portfolio with Reported Losses from SVB.

Goldman Sachs purchased the bond portfolio that caused Silicon Valley Bank to book a $1.8 billion loss, leading to the bank's failed attempt at a $2.25 billion stock sale. The portfolio consisted mainly of U.S. Treasuries and had a book value of $23.97 billion. The transaction was carried out "at negotiated prices" and netted the bank $21.45 billion in proceeds. The purchase was handled by a division separate from the unit that handled SVB's stock sale. Silicon Valley Bank was shut down by the FDIC after losing $2 billion, becoming the largest bank failure since the financial crisis.
